Korea considers deployment of NuScale SMR for hydrogen
Private power generation company GS Energy has signed a memorandum of understanding with Uljin County in North Gyeongsang Province, South Korea, to consider the use of NuScale Power's small modular reactor technology to provide heat and power to the planned Uljin Nuclear Hydrogen National Industrial Complex.;

Renewable Energy 2024
According to the 2024 Korea Energy Agency (KEA) Energy Handbook, the proportion of NRE sources accountable for total domestic power generation in South Korea increased from 4.99% in 2018 to 5.81% in 2019, 7.44% in 2020, 8.29% in 2021, and 9.22% in 2022. It is projected to increase to 10.6% in 2023.

SOUTH KOREA
South Korea needs to reduce its emissions to below 217 MtCO 2 e by 2030 and to below -309 MtCO 2 e (net sink) by 2050 to be within its ''fair-share'' compatible range. South Korea''s 2030 NDC, however, would only limit its emissions to 539 MtCO 2 e. All figures exclude land use emissions and are based on pre-COVID-19 projections. SOUTH KOREA

How much energy does South Korea use?
In 2022, South Korea was the eighth largest energy-consuming country in the world, with over 12 exajoules of primary energy consumed domestically. To meet this demand, the country depends mainly on fossil fuels and nuclear energy.
What percentage of South Korea's energy consumption is renewable?
Although renewables accounted for the smallest portion (3%) of South Korea’s primary energy consumption in 2021, renewables were the only energy source with a steadily increasing share since 2015. At that time, renewables accounted for less than 1% of total energy consumption.5
How does South Korea diversify its energy supply?
To diversify its energy supply, South Korea has implemented multiple strategies, leaning more toward alternative and renewable energy sources such as solar, wind, and hydrogen-based energy production.

What percentage of South Korea's electricity comes from nuclear power?
Fossil fuels accounted for two-thirds of South Korea’s electricity generation in 2021, and nuclear power accounted for 26%.
